At 01:35 PM 11/5/03 -0600, you wrote: >Woodie, > >I'll try to help as best as I can, but I recommend that you subscribe to the >TrashFinder mailing list for this particular conversation at: >[EMAIL PROTECTED] >With the text in the message body: subscribe trash_finder > >1) TrashFinder uses both the .RCP and .MSG files for analysis >2) TF use straighforward text matching, so for "n9.scd.groups.yahoo.com" you >could just enter "groups.yahoo.com" and catch all those messages. I try to >be very careful with this. I have also have encountered some issues where >putting in the server dns name seems to work better. >3) TF creates a great log file every month, which details what it is doing. >Once I started reading it, I I stopped bothering Randy, as it became >immediately apparent what was actually going on. >4) TF does not read beyond the HTML boundries, so for me to remove >Antibanner, I had to activate HTML Content as a detection method. >5) 98% of my regular messages are passing through, once I got all of the >routine addresses entered into the "EXCEPTIONS, Pass Addresses" area, and >moved my antibanner keywords to "Text Body-Trash", and removed my >antibanner. >6) ALL OF MY SETTINGS in TF are set to "Trash" (No Spam or DELETE, which is >not the default). >7) Only a select group of "Text Body" and "From's" are using the DELETE >function. > >My goal was to pass all regular mail, and hold most everything else for >analysis, and relay any good mail found. > >I hope this helps. > >John Martoccio >Intelligent Solutions >[EMAIL PROTECTED] > >> -----Original Message----- >> From: [EMAIL PROTECTED] >> [mailto:[EMAIL PROTECTED] Behalf Of Woodie Sayles >> Sent: Wednesday, November 05, 2003 10:09 AM >> To: [email protected] >> Subject: RE: TF filter settings >> >> >> I found I had to bypass those two filters because it was >> catching too many >> good emails, too. >> >> Woodie Sayles >> [EMAIL PROTECTED] >> Webfoot.Net >> 2054 Weaver Park Drive >> Clearwater, FL 33765-2130 >> (727) 442-5770 >> (727) 442-3380 - fax >> >> Fast, friendly, professional web design and hosting. >> Visit our web site at http://www.webfoot.net to see what we >> can do for you! >> >> >> >> -----Original Message----- >> From: [EMAIL PROTECTED] >> [mailto:[EMAIL PROTECTED] Behalf Of Kerry Barlow >> Sent: Wednesday, November 05, 2003 10:56 AM >> To: [email protected] >> Subject: TF filter settings >> >> >> Hello all: I would appreciate it, if somebody could send me their >> TrashFinder settings.
